Advanced PNT Technologies
The PNT Technologies Based Facility at IIT Tirupati Navavishkar I-Hub Foundation (IITTNiF) is a dedicated center for advancing Positioning, Navigation, and Timing (PNT) technologies with a special focus on India’s indigenous NavIC system and next-generation GNSS applications. The facility is equipped with state-of-the-art infrastructure including advanced RF test equipment, NavIC test bed, GNSS signal simulators, multi-constellation reference receivers, SDR and FPGA platforms, antenna measurement systems, timing and synchronization setups, and industry-grade development tools—enabling end-to-end research, testing, validation, and prototype development.
The facility undertakes advanced research and product development in GNSS/NavIC antennas, RF front-ends, receivers, secure navigation systems, anti-jamming and anti-spoofing technologies, timing applications, ionospheric studies, and integrated PNT solutions. The research activities support application domains such as autonomous systems, smart transportation, space technologies, defense navigation, telecom synchronization, and strategic national projects.
In addition, the facility conducts training, skilling, and capacity-building programs for students, researchers, startups, industry professionals, and academic institutions, providing hands-on exposure to GNSS, NavIC, SDR, FPGA, RF testing, and secure PNT technologies. Through strong collaborations with academia, industries, government organizations, and strategic sectors, along with its “Lab as a Service (LaaS)” model, the facility aims to accelerate indigenous technology development, strengthen India’s self-reliance in Positioning, Navigation, and Timing systems, and foster a vibrant PNT innovation ecosystem.

About PNT
Positioning, Navigation, and Timing (PNT) technologies provide accurate location, navigation, velocity, and time synchronization information essential for modern technological systems and critical infrastructure. PNT systems play a vital role in enabling reliable positioning, precise timing, and secure navigation for a wide range of civilian, industrial, scientific, and strategic applications.
PNT services are primarily enabled through Global Navigation Satellite Systems (GNSS) such as GPS, GLONASS, Galileo, BeiDou, and India’s indigenous NavIC system. These systems support real-time positioning and synchronization capabilities for applications including transportation, autonomous systems, telecommunications, power grids, defence systems, precision agriculture, disaster management, and scientific research.
Modern PNT technologies integrate advanced GNSS receivers, SDR platforms, FPGA-based processing systems, RF monitoring tools, and secure navigation techniques to enhance accuracy, reliability, integrity, and resilience. Research in PNT also includes areas such as anti-jamming, anti-spoofing, signal authentication, timing synchronization, and multi-constellation navigation systems.
The fundamental principle of PNT systems is based on receiving signals from multiple satellites and calculating precise position and timing information using advanced signal processing and trilateration techniques. These technologies are critical for enabling next-generation intelligent transportation, smart infrastructure, autonomous navigation, secure communication, and national strategic applications.
With continuous advancements in satellite navigation and secure timing technologies, PNT systems are becoming increasingly important in building resilient, accurate, and high-performance navigation ecosystems for the future.
